One comment about being cat-called was this one:

Molly said...

I totally understand why these types of comments upset people and I agree that they can be offensive but I must say it really doesn't bother me at all. Clearly these guys aren't choosey about who they talk to and I certainly doubt they actually expect someone to stop what theyre doing and take them up on their charming offers, so as far as I'm concerned it's just more noise. I ignore sirens and car horns both of which are annoying and distracting; I think of cat-calls the same way. They're just background noise. Ive gotten so good at ignoring them that at this point I often don't even notice it happens until a friend points it out. And I know it is waaaaayy more common for guys to do this, but I've heard women do it too.



This is different than what most women have posted on here... what are everyone's thoughts?
